Editorial policy
- Five pillars: market intelligence, the Founder's Desk, engagement-leadership point of view, practitioner guides, and client outcomes.
- Every market figure names its source and carries an as-of stamp; every index score has a published methodology and changelog.
- Client proof is sector-only until written consent exists; testimonials are labelled representative outcomes until attributed.
- Machine-assisted drafts land as drafts. A named human reviewer approves before anything publishes.
- Corrections are made in place with a dated note; nothing is silently rewritten.

Progress Software Expands Indian Presence with New Office and Stronger Commitment to Talent
This month, Progress Software, a leading software company, announced its expansion into India with the opening of a new office at Embassy Tech Village in Bengaluru. The company aims to strengthen its India Global Capability Centre and further enhance its position as a major player in the Indian software industry.
